Night of Museums 2026 at Aeropark

Airport Night at Aeropark

Take off into Hungary’s aviation history

On June 20, 2026, from 5:00 PM until 2:00 AM, Budapest’s Aeropark invites you to experience a magical evening where history takes flight. As part of the annual Night of Museums celebration, the open-air aviation museum at Budapest Ferenc Liszt International Airport transforms into a vibrant haven for aviation lovers, families, and curious travelers alike.

This living museum showcases the fascinating story of Hungarian civil aviation—from the heroic early days to the modern age. Visitors can walk among historic aircraft, explore illuminated cockpits and passenger cabins, and feel the pulse of roaring engines that once ruled the skies.

Meet the machines that made history

During the evening, Aeropark’s aircraft come to life under the summer night lights. You can step inside vintage planes, chat with former and active pilots, flight attendants, and air traffic controllers, and even jump into simulators that let you experience the thrill of piloting an aircraft yourself.
